Transaction 42b322c7667e62e80cf3cbb00a643a2bca09573b03bf18e2d88ef07009f0361a

1 Input
2 Outputs
  • 42b322c7667e62e80cf3cbb00a643a2bca09573b03bf18e2d88ef07009f0361a:0
  • value  850971
    address  3FLQ55L7sFohu4kJhwxYN9AqkqbM5VkR18
  • 42b322c7667e62e80cf3cbb00a643a2bca09573b03bf18e2d88ef07009f0361a:1
  • value  170484111
    address  15cKzWRPG44tMWVMNoiexHiVnsXRwzBa3x